Ahead of the "Field of Dreams" game in Iowa on Aug. 12, the New York Yankees and Chicago White Sox unveiled their uniforms -- inspired by team jerseys worn in the early 20th century -- for the first-time special event.

The White Sox uniforms feature navy blue pinstripes and a large SOX monogram on the left chest, which will match a white cap with navy blue pinstripes. During batting practice, the team will wear a navy cap with the Sox monogram.

The Yankees unveiled a uniform featuring the NEW YORK lettering in a thinner and wider typeface than the modern-day jersey, featured in navy blue on gray with no white outline or sleeve trim. The cap features a loose-knit interlocking NY.
